In 2070, a zombie virus threatens mankind. A futuristic, dystopian, cyberpunk test of survival!
Author's Note: The year is 2070, one year after the Collapse. The place? New Vance City. Skeletal remains of skyscrapers pierce the smog-choked sky. Patches of overgrown desert flora claw at cracked asphalt. Inside, survivors try to make the best of their fragile existence, repurposing solar panels and scavenging for supplies. Kids born into this hell hole play amongst the ruins of the city, their laughter a thin, hopeful melody that just isn't strong enough to pierce through the grim ambiance of the city.
Life here is filled with nothing but scarcity and fear. Every creak in the night, every flicker in the solar grid, every hum or buzz... It's all enough to send shivers down your spines. Patrols, armed with anything from repurposed energy weapons to hastily thrown together pipe rifles scan the horizon for "shamblers," the remnants of the infected. Yet amidst the hardship, the community is still blooming. New Vance City still stands, at least for now. A flickering candle in the encroaching darkness of a world forever changed.

Bonus Action. You hurl a vial or container filled with a corrosive or debilitating scavenged chemical. Choose one creature within 30 feet. The target must make a Dexterity saving throw. On a failed save, the target takes 4d8 acid damage and has disadvantage on attack rolls or ability checks it makes before the end of its next turn due to irritation. On a successful save, the target takes half damage and suffers no other effect. Range: 30 feet. Duration: Instantaneous.
